Ron Moore is the elected District Attorney for the 28th District, Buncombe County, North Carolina and is a graduate of the University of North Carolina, with a Bachelor's Degree in History and Juris Doctor. He resides with his wife Mary Elizabeth, a practicing attorney and their daughter, Lexie in Asheville, NC where he enjoys hunting, fly fishing, reading and photography. D.A. Moore was the first prosecutor in the state of North Carolina to be recognized by the board of Legal Specialization as a Criminal Law Specialist and has been honored by the state for his work with; the NC Conference of District Attorneys, Trial Advocacy, the Governor's Commission on Juvenile Crime and Justice, the Sentencing and Policy Advisory Commission, and was a Trial Advocacy Instructor at the National District Attorney's Advocacy Center, University of South Carolina, Columbia, SC.

Quail Unlimited (QU) is a 501(c)(3) organization dedicated to the restoration of habitat for wild quail. Its almost 300 chapters nationwide raise local project dollars for on-the-ground projects, including private and public land management with banquets, auctions, sporting clay events and more. QU has a highly trained staff of biologists, state and regional directors and dedicated members that work with private landowners and state and federal agencies to restore quail populations.
